Wilma Laverne Jamison, 84, of San Augustine, Texas, passed away on March 12, 2024, surrounded by loved ones in San Augustine, Texas. She was born on February 22, 1940, in San Augustine, Texas, to the late Floyd Hardy and Tassie (Chumley) Hardy.
Visitation will be held from 10:00-11:00 AM on Saturday, March 16,2024, at Mangum Funeral Home, Center. Graveside service will follow on Saturday at Rather Cemetery with Bro. Michael McArthur officiating.
Wilma was raised in San Augustine, Texas. She graduated from San Augustine High School. Wilma received her Cosmetology License and worked for over 50 years doing what she loved, styling hair. Wilma loved her family and enjoyed the time spent with them. She also loved drawing and painting, working in her flower beds and gardening. She worked for many years creating special arrangements at Kroger's in the floral department. She will always be remembered as a hardworking, kind, and compassionate person.

Wilma is preceded in death by her loving husband, J.V. Jamison; parents, Floyd and Tassie Hardy; brothers, Pat Hardy, John Earl Green; sisters, Louise Hillyer, Dora Lee Bennefield, and Abby Ruth Smith.
